top of page

Flecanid 100mg extended-release capsule

This is a prescription drug and requires a valid prescription when ordering

Flecanid 100mg extended-release capsule

SKU: 5484
€ 13,61Pris
  • This is a prescription drug and requires a valid prescription when ordering

bottom of page